1999: Split time in the outfield, becoming a regular face in the starting lineup towards the end of the season ... appeared in 32 games, making 17 starts ... recorded eight hits in 45 at bats and scored five runs ... enjoyed one of the best games of her career in a 3-2 win over Toledo ... she was 2-for-2 and scored one run against the Rockets ... it was her lone multiple hit game of the season ... tagged the lone double of her career in Miami's 3-0 win at Eastern Michigan ... posted her first career hit on March 10 against Florida State ... was 3-4 in stolen bases ... tallied eight hits in 45 at bats.
1998: Played in 25 games ... recorded 10 runs as a pinch runner ... scored runs in seven games over a nine-game span ... was 4-for-5 in stolen bases.
Prior to Miami: Hit .364 as a senior ... set school records by stealing 46-of-46 bases in one season and 105-of-106 bases for her career ... chosen first-team all-conference three consecutive years ... honorable mention academic all-state.
Personal: Born September 11, 1978 (22 years old) ... daughter of Jennifer and Steve Neal ... international studies major.
